Inter Milan Eye Rasmus Hojlund in Summer Swoop

Rasmus Hojlund has made his stance clear to stay at Manchester United, even as Inter Milan begin transfer discussions.

Hojlund Keen to Stay at United Despite Inter Milan Interest

Rasmus Hojlund is a subject of strong interest from Inter Milan. However, the Danish forward does not want to leave Man Utd this summer. He has opened dialogue between the Serie A giants. But, sources close to him revealed he wants to stay at Old Trafford. He wants to show his quality under new manager Ruben Amorim.

Rasmus had a tough first season at the club after his £72 million move from Atalanta in 2023. Although, he bagged 16 goals across all competitions, fans expected more consistent form. With Anthony Martial injured most of the season, the Dane was brought into the spotlight as the main striker. That is something that may have come a bit too early in his development. Late in the season, his form dipped heavily, sparking transfer rumours across Europe.

Man Utd Focused on Rebuilding Despite European Setback

The Red Devils haven’t ruled out selling any player this summer if the right offer comes in. They have missed out on UCL football after losing the Europa League final to Tottenham. That has impacted the club’s transfer strength.

However, Utd are still moving quickly in the market. They recently agreed to sign Matheus Cunha from Wolves for £62.5 million. They are also pushing hard to land Brentford winger Bryan Mbeumo for a reported £50 million.

Meanwhile, Inter Milan are desperate for new firepower after their heavy 5-0 loss to PSG in the Champions League final. Hojlund is one of two forwards they’re targeting, alongside Parma’s Ange-Yoan Bonny.

Still, unless Utd receive a massive offer, Hojlund is expected to stay. He will be fighting for a stronger second season.
